On 04/12/2012 10:23, Brent McPherson wrote:
Hi Eugen,
Yes, it would be simple to do with the Tool SDK.
In fact, we already have a spot light creation tool example that
ships with Softimage (search for SpotLightCreateTool in the custom
tools addon) so only the reflected ray part would need to be added.
Anyone up for the challenge? ;-)
Belatedly picking up the gauntlet and thread. Had some time to fiddle
around with the Tool SDK over the Christmas holidays and cannibalised
the SpotLightCreateTool as Brent suggested. Tool SDK has been great
to work with. I'm in renewed awe of Piotrek Marczak's work
(Meshpaint, Soft
Transform) using the SDK. First usable stab linked below (addon and
movie).
